| <?xml version="1.0" encoding="UTF-8"?> |
| <?eclipse version="3.1"?> |
| <plugin> |
| <extension-point id="modelUpdater" name="Shared Model Updater" schema="schema/modelUpdater.exsd"/> |
| <extension |
| point="org.eclipse.core.runtime.adapters"> |
| <factory |
| adaptableType="org.eclipse.ecf.core.sharedobject.ISharedObjectContainer" |
| class="org.eclipse.ecf.pubsub.impl.PubSubAdapterFactory"> |
| <adapter type="org.eclipse.ecf.pubsub.IPublishedServiceDirectory"/> |
| <adapter type="org.eclipse.ecf.pubsub.IPublishedServiceRequestor"/> |
| </factory> |
| </extension> |
| <extension |
| point="org.eclipse.ui.views"> |
| <view |
| class="org.eclipse.ecf.example.pubsub.PubSubView" |
| id="org.eclipse.ecf.example.pubsub.publications" |
| name="Published Services"/> |
| <view |
| allowMultiple="true" |
| class="org.eclipse.ecf.example.pubsub.SubscriptionView" |
| id="org.eclipse.ecf.example.pubsub.subscription" |
| name="Subscription"/> |
| </extension> |
| <extension |
| point="org.eclipse.ecf.example.pubsub.modelUpdater"> |
| <modelUpdater |
| class="org.eclipse.ecf.example.pubsub.ListAppender" |
| id="org.eclipse.ecf.example.pubsub.ListAppender"/> |
| </extension> |
| |
| </plugin> |